As a Credit Risk Measurement and Analytics Associate in Credit Risk Measurement and Analytics, you help us measure, monitor, and communicate credit and market risk across marketable-securities-backed lending, capital markets, and derivatives activity. You work with partners across risk, lending and trading solutions, lending teams, investors, and finance to help ensure collateral frameworks, stress testing, and risk appetite measurement are robust and timely. You join a global, delegated coverage model spanning multiple regions, where we actively manage risk through proactive analytics and high industry standards. You will guide decision-making by translating fast-moving market events into practical risk insights and clear recommendations. Required qualifications, capabilities, and skills 3+ years in an analytical, technical, trading, or research-oriented role Academic background in, or professional experience with, financial mathematics, quantitative risk methodologies, and/or data science Broad financial product knowledge required, professional experience in credit risk management, market risk management, or with derivatives a plus Practical knowledge of Python and associated data analytics packages (preferably in a professional environment) Practical knowledge of Tableau or other Business Intelligence (BI) / Data Visualization Tools Practical knowledge of Microsoft office suite (Excel/PowerPoint/Word) Excellent communication and interpersonal skills Good team player, and high sense of ownership Demonstrated ability to collaborate across teams and stakeholders Preferred qualifications, capabilities and skills Undergraduate degree required, concentrations in technical disciplines preferred; Graduate degree, or professional designations a plus Professional experience in credit risk management or market risk management Professional experience supporting derivatives activity Experience with business intelligence and data visualization tools (for example, Tableau) Experience supporting stress testing deliverables and related governance processes Experience improving control frameworks, documentation, reporting, or metrics in a risk environment
